When is the best time to book my B&B in Greenville?
When you’re planning your trip to Greenville,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 74°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 36°F. Average annual precipitation for Greenville is 51 inches.
What is there to do in Greenville?
When you want to check out some attractions in town, you might consider a visit to Greenville Country Club and Patriot’s Park. You might also consider a trip to sites like Copper Dock Winery or Carlyle Lake if you have time to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Greenville?
You can plan your excursions in and around Greenville 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Lambert-St. Louis International Airport (STL), which is located 51.6 mi (83.1 km) away from the heart of the city.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
